How billing works
Payment processor
Subsail bills accounts on a monthly basis using a service called Paddle. Your receipts will show “PADDLE” in the descriptor text in your bank account.
Automatic upgrades
If you are on the Starter plan, you will automatically be upgraded to the Regular plan when you hit your plan limit of 100 subscriptions. You will receive an alert by email when you are 10 subscriptions away from your upgrade.
